Changbai Mountain Reserve
Basic information
Sample name: Changbai Mountain Reserve

Reference: H. Yang and Y. Wu. 1987. Tree composition, age structure and regeneration strategy of the mixed broadleaved/Pinus koraiensis (Korean pine) forest in Changbai Mountain Reserve. In The Temperate Forest Ecosystem (eds. H. Yang, Z. Wang, J. N. R. Jeffers, P. A. Ward), pp. 12-20 [ER 36]
Geography
Country: China

State: Jilin


Coordinate: 42° 4' N, 128° 0' E
Coordinate basis: stated in text as range

Geography comments: coordinate is based on Yang and Xu (2003, Biodiversity and Conservation)

Environment
Habitat: temperate broadleaf/mixed forest

Substrate: ground surface

MAT: 2.8

MAP: 680.0

Habitat comments: JA: total area of the reserve is 190,000 ha
climate data are for 740 m (MAP) and 700 m (MAT) and are from Yu et al. (2011, Annals of Forest Science)

Methods
Life forms: trees

Sites: 1

Site area: 0.7

Sampling methods: line transect

Sample size: 278 individuals

Size min: 10

Basal area: 19.903

Abundance distribution
8 species
0 singletons
total count 278
extrapolated richness: 8.7
Fisher's α: 1.538
geometric series k: 0.6132
Hurlbert's PIE: 0.7904
Shannon's H: 1.7545
Good's u: 1.0000
